1. Choosing the Right Wall for Your Canvas Prints

One of the most crucial steps in displaying large canvas photo prints is selecting the right wall. It’s essential to ensure that the space you choose has enough room for the print without overwhelming the room. A large canvas can dominate a wall if not placed correctly, so consider the proportions of the wall and the size of your print.

Here are some ideas for placing your canvas photo prints:

  • Living Room: The living room is the perfect place for large canvas prints. Consider placing your print above the sofa or fireplace to create a focal point. Ensure the print complements the furniture and color scheme to maintain harmony in the room.

  • Bedroom: A large canvas print above the bed adds a sense of relaxation and warmth. Choose calming colors or a personal image that brings comfort to your space.

  • Hallways: Hallways are often underutilized when it comes to home decor. Hanging a large canvas in a hallway can turn a dull space into an eye-catching gallery that leads guests through your home.

2. How to Properly Hang Your Canvas Prints

Once you’ve chosen the perfect wall for your large canvas photo prints, it's time to hang them. Proper hanging techniques are essential to avoid damaging your print or your walls. Here are a few tips to ensure the correct placement:

  • Height: A general rule is to hang the print so that the center is at eye level. This creates a more visually balanced display. For larger prints, you may want to lower the print slightly to accommodate the scale of the image.

  • Spacing: When hanging multiple prints together, leave an even amount of space between each canvas. The spacing should be proportionate to the size of the prints. For example, if you're hanging three large canvas prints in a row, a 3-5 inch gap between each piece is ideal.

  • Tools: Use a level, measuring tape, and appropriate wall anchors to ensure your prints hang securely and straight. If the print is particularly heavy, consider using picture hooks designed to hold larger frames.

3. Creating a Gallery Wall with Canvas Prints

One popular way to display multiple large canvas photo prints is by creating a gallery wall. This allows you to showcase a collection of prints that complement one another. You can mix and match different sizes or maintain a consistent theme across your prints.

  • Matching Themes: Keep a consistent theme across the prints. Whether it’s family photos, nature landscapes, or abstract art, the key is to ensure they work together as a cohesive group.

  • Different Sizes: Play with different canvas sizes to add variety and interest. A combination of large and medium-sized canvases can create a balanced and dynamic display.

  • Symmetry or Asymmetry: Decide whether you want the gallery wall to have a symmetrical feel or an asymmetrical, more eclectic look. Both styles can be striking, depending on your space.

5. Maintaining Your Large Canvas Prints

To keep your large canvas photo prints looking fresh and vibrant, regular maintenance is essential. Here are some tips:

  • Dusting: Use a soft cloth or a microfiber duster to gently remove dust from your prints. Avoid using harsh chemicals or cleaning solutions that may damage the canvas material.

  • Avoid Direct Sunlight: While natural light can enhance the beauty of your prints, prolonged exposure to direct sunlight can cause fading. Position your prints in areas with indirect sunlight to preserve their colors.

  • Protective Coating: Some canvas prints come with a protective coating that helps shield them from dust, dirt, and UV rays. If not, you may want to invest in a frame with UV-protective glass to help prolong the life of your print.
